2016-10-11 21 views
-1

template-tags.phpファイルのTwentySixteen Wordpressテーマのentry_meta()関数に投稿タイトルを追加したいと思います。著者情報の前に印刷したいと思います。アバター画像の後に。Wordpress - 投稿のタイトルをentry_meta関数に追加する

は、基本的に「スクリーンリーダーテキスト」スパンの直前です。

機能部:

if ('post' === get_post_type()) { 
    $author_avatar_size = apply_filters('twentysixteen_author_avatar_size', 205); 
    printf('<span class="byline"><span class="author vcard">%1$s<span class="screen-reader-text">%2$s </span> <a class="url fn n" href="%3$s">%4$s</a></span></span>', 
     get_avatar(get_the_author_meta('user_email'), $author_avatar_size), 
     _x('Author', 'Used before post author name.', 'twentysixteen'), 
     esc_url(get_author_posts_url(get_the_author_meta('ID'))), 
     get_the_author() 
    ); 
} 

追加the_title()のprintfでは実際に動作しません。だから、これにどのように接近するのか分からない。

ご協力いただきありがとうございました。

答えて

0

は(get_the_titleを追加)し、%5 $ sの

if ('post' === get_post_type()) { 
    $author_avatar_size = apply_filters('twentysixteen_author_avatar_size', 205); 
    printf('<span class="byline"><span class="author vcard">%1$s<h1 class="entry-title">%5$s</h1><span class="screen-reader-text">%2$s </span> <a class="url fn n" href="%3$s">%4$s</a></span></span>', 
     get_avatar(get_the_author_meta('user_email'), $author_avatar_size), 
     _x('Author', 'Used before post author name.', 'twentysixteen'), 
     esc_url(get_author_posts_url(get_the_author_meta('ID'))), 
     get_the_author(), 
     get_the_title() 
    ); 
} 
でそれを呼ばれます
関連する問題